Due to a relative lack of activity in recent months, the posts from the Media / Post Your Photos section (along with several others) were merged into this section (Sidecar Paddock) and can still be found in here. Similarly, please continue to post all photos and videos on the forum, just use this more general area.

The site admin team felt that the forum is now somewhat quiet in terms of those starting new threads and / or commenting on existing ones, and there is no longer a necessity to split up topics into a vast number of sub-forums. While visitor traffic is still high, those logging in and posting is much lower than in the past. I will say that we still have a huge number of readers of this site and forum (along with a good number of contributors) who choose not to use "social media", so still rely on this forum for reliable news updates and sensible debate - and of course view the excellent photographs and videos which are posted by our members.
